Global manufacturer Sevcon needed to replace ageing and disparate IT systems running at its five international sites. A lack of integration meant that business managers were unable to get an accurate, up-to-date view of the company. Sevcon worked with Microsoft Gold Certified Partner Columbus IT to deploy Microsoft Dynamics AX business management software, supported by the Microsoft server infrastructure. The new solution is easily customized to meet manufacturing needs, can grow with the business, and offers flexibility at Sevcon sites in different countries. Employees can connect to the network and use one single source of business information no matter their location. Customers and shareholders are getting greater value from a system that both supports and adapts to business needs.
